Early One Morning is a raw, unsettling exploration of a man's descent into violence. The pacing is tight, almost claustrophobic, as we follow Paul Wertret's harrowing morning. The film captures the mundane routine of office life, then contrasts it sharply with sudden, brutal action. The atmosphere is heavy, lending itself to a slow build-up that's punctuated by chaos. What stands out are the performancesâparticularly the lead, who embodies a quiet desperation. Thereâs a stark realism to the practical effects that doesnât shy away from the horror of the situation. It feels like a stark commentary on corporate culture and the pressures that can lead to such extreme acts. Definitely a unique take on the thriller genre.
